CERTIFIED COASTAL BERMUDA GRASS 


Coastal has proved its superiority for grazing and hay during 
dry and wet spells. Ask for sheet giving information or contact 
your county agent. Propagated by stolons or sprigs and not seed. 
Use 5,000 to 10,000 per acre. Can be set out any time when moist- 
ure is plentiful or irrigation is available except freezing weather. 
Can furnish in b f. o. b. our grower’s farm east of Greenville, 
Ala., for your stake-body truck to pick up. We dig every day 
except Sat. & Sun. Make arrangements with us before sending 
trucks. Get “special prices” on large quantities.

OUR SEED LABORATORY 


We have had a Seed Laboratory for years to check 
and test the seed we buy and sell. This is for your 
protection and ours, and we know you appreciate 
the great value of this. Our analyst, Earl Lott, is 
a Registered Senior Member of the Society of Com- 
mercial Seed Technologists. His tests are acceptable 
to ASC in all states and to other SECO There 
are only 107 Senior Analysts in the U

tJAPANESE MILLET wonderful duck feed. Plant 
where ponds & lakes recede or go dry. Makes quick 
growth. Will actually grow in shallow water. Ducks 
dive down to eat seed. Excellent!
